Jerry William Riffle
Jerry William Riffle, 86, Syracuse, passed away at 2:15 p.m. on Saturday, Nov. 28, 2020, at his home. He was born on Jan. 7, 1934, in Mishawaka, to John Henry and Helen Gertrude (Washburn) Riffle.
He graduated in 1952 from Central High School in South Bend. He attended Indiana University in South Bend and graduated in 1957 from Forestry School at Michigan State University in East Lansing, Mich. with his B.S. Degree. He continued graduate school at Michigan State University and received his Master of Science Degree from the Department of Botany and Plant Pathology. He then attended the University of Wisconsin in Madison, Wisc. where he received a Ph. D. Degree from the Department of Plant Pathology. He was married on June 20, 1959, in Fenton, Mich. to Nancy L. Robinson who survives.
He was a Forest Pathologist with the United States Forestry Service and retired in 1986 after 30+ years. After retirement he was a compliance officer for the Wawasee Community School Corporation for three years and Director of Tree / Shrub and Lawn Care Division at Ace Pest Control in North Webster for 27 years working with his good friend Greg Long. In his early years he formerly worked at Kreamo Bakery and Studebaker Corporation both in South Bend.
He moved to Syracuse in 1986 and formerly lived in Albuquerque, N.M. for ten years amd Lincoln, Neb. for 15 years. He was a member of the St. Anne’s Episcopal Church in Warsaw, member and past president of the Syracuse-Wawasee Rotary Club, advisory member of Syracuse Park Board, charter member of Syracuse Tree Board and Town Forester in Syracuse, member of Wawasee High School Site Based Improvement Committee, member of the Ecology Foundation, Wawasee Area Conservancy District, member and past chairman of the Northern Communities Division, United Way of Kosciusko County, founder of the Tree City USA program for Syracuse, and Arbor Day celebration for Syracuse Elementary School.
